Why Are Custom Alloy Steel Sizes and Specifications Important?

Alloy steel is used where specific mechanical, thermal, corrosion, or wear-resistance properties are required. Different construction and industrial applications may require different grades and dimensions.

For example, a project may specify:

  • A particular alloy steel grade

  • Custom plate or bar dimensions

  • Specific wall thicknesses

  • Defined outside or inside diameters

  • Cut-to-length components

  • Required heat-treatment conditions

  • Particular mechanical properties

  • Specific surface or finishing requirements

Using a standard product that does not match the engineering specification can create fabrication problems, additional machining requirements, material waste, or compliance concerns.

For this reason, contractors should provide suppliers with the approved material specification before requesting a quotation.

What Should a Supplier Be Able to Customize?

The level of customization depends on the supplier's inventory, processing capabilities, manufacturing partnerships, and approved supply network.

Dimensions and Cutting

Some suppliers can provide alloy steel plates, bars, rods, pipes, or other products in specific lengths and dimensions. Cut-to-size supply can reduce fabrication work and material wastage at the project site.

Material Grade

Different alloy compositions provide different performance characteristics. Buyers should ensure that the supplied grade matches the engineering design, application requirements, and applicable industry standards.

Thickness and Diameter

Industrial applications may require precise thicknesses or diameters. This is particularly important for components exposed to pressure, temperature, structural loads, or demanding operating environments.

Heat Treatment

Certain alloy steel applications may require specific heat-treatment conditions to achieve the required hardness, strength, or other mechanical properties. Procurement teams should confirm whether heat treatment is included in the supply requirement.

How Can Contractors Find the Right Supplier?

Choosing a supplier should begin with the project's technical requirements rather than simply comparing prices.

Start by preparing a detailed material request containing the grade, dimensions, quantity, applicable standards, testing requirements, delivery location, and required documentation.

Then compare suppliers based on their ability to fulfill the complete requirement.

Important evaluation criteria include:

  1. Technical capability: Can the supplier provide the requested grade and dimensions?

  2. Product availability: Is the required material available locally or through an established supply chain?

  3. Quality documentation: Can the supplier provide relevant certificates and inspection records?

  4. Customization: Can materials be cut or processed according to project requirements?

  5. Lead time: Can the supplier meet the project's procurement schedule?

  6. Delivery capability: Can materials be transported safely to the required location?

  7. Communication: Does the supplier respond clearly to technical and commercial queries?

What Certifications and Documents Should Buyers Check?

Quality assurance is especially important when alloy steel is being incorporated into critical construction or industrial applications.

Depending on the product and project requirements, buyers may need material test certificates, certificates of conformity, inspection documentation, heat-treatment records, or traceability information.

Procurement teams should verify that documentation corresponds to the actual supplied material. Material identification, grade, heat number, dimensions, and testing information should be checked against the purchase order and approved specifications.

Where a project specifies particular standards, the supplier should be able to demonstrate that the offered material meets those requirements.

Factors That Affect Custom Alloy Steel Pricing

Custom material generally requires more evaluation than standard stock, so pricing can vary considerably between orders.

Factors affecting the final cost may include:

  • Alloy steel grade

  • Material quantity

  • Thickness and dimensions

  • Custom cutting or processing

  • Heat treatment

  • Testing and inspection requirements

  • Certification and documentation

  • Local availability

  • Import requirements

  • Transportation distance

  • Delivery urgency

  • Market conditions

A lower initial quotation is not necessarily the most economical option. Contractors should compare the complete delivered cost and consider whether the supplier can meet technical and scheduling requirements without creating additional fabrication or project-management costs.

How Do You Decide Between Local Stock and Custom Supply?

The decision depends on the project's urgency, specifications, quantity, and fabrication requirements.

Local stock may be suitable when standard dimensions are acceptable and materials are needed quickly. It can reduce lead times and simplify transportation.

Custom supply may be preferable when the project requires specific dimensions, grades, or processing that are not readily available from standard inventory.

For large construction projects, procurement teams can also discuss partial deliveries. Receiving critical materials in planned batches can help align material availability with construction activities while reducing unnecessary site storage.

Common Challenges When Ordering Custom Alloy Steel

Custom sourcing can involve several risks if requirements are not clearly communicated.

One common problem is incomplete specifications. A request that only states the material type without grade, dimensions, standards, or testing requirements may result in unsuitable quotations.

Another challenge is lead time. Specialized grades or non-standard dimensions may require sourcing from another location or manufacturing facility.

Delivery coordination can also become difficult when materials are oversized, heavy, or required at a specific stage of construction. Project management and logistics teams should therefore agree on delivery requirements before the purchase order is finalized.

Decision-Making Checklist for Buyers

Before selecting a supplier, construction companies and contractors should confirm the following:

  • Does the offered material match the approved engineering specification?

  • Are the required dimensions available or customizable?

  • Can the supplier provide appropriate quality documentation?

  • Is material traceability available where required?

  • What is the confirmed lead time?

  • Are cutting, testing, or treatment services included?

  • What are the transportation arrangements?

  • Can the supplier support phased or urgent deliveries?

  • Are commercial terms and payment conditions clearly defined?

  • Does the supplier have experience with comparable industrial requirements?

Getting these points confirmed in writing can reduce procurement misunderstandings and improve risk management.
